With AutoZone's wide selection, you can easily find the right antifreeze for your specific make … try hack me premium accountWebOct 4, 2024 · The first coolant was Inorganic Acid Technology (IAT). It’s good for a while (around 30,000 miles), but eventually becomes too acidic and has to be changed. Some older cars still use it. Next was Organic Acid Technology or OAT coolant.
